Quarterly Planning Note — Divestiture of the Coastal Tooling Unit

For the finance team: the sale of the Coastal Tooling unit to Pellmark Industries remains on track for close in Q3. Please finalize the carve-out balance sheet, reconcile intercompany positions, and prepare the working-capital adjustment schedule by month-end. Audit support requests should be prioritized. For planning purposes, note the following sensitive item:

internal memo for hawef-kahif: The finance team signed off on a budget of $25.9 million for Project Sorox. The renewal with Pelokek Logistics closes at $51.7 million a year, 52 percent below the last contract.

**Mgmt Meeting Minutes — Retiring the Brightline Range**

Quick recap for sales leads at Fenholt Supplies: we agreed to retire the Brightline fixture range by year-end. Remaining stock moves to clearance pricing next month, and accounts on standing orders get migrated to the Lumetta range. Trade-in incentives were approved in principle. The confidential note on next steps sits just below.

board note of bajof-bajeg: The pricing group signed off on a budget of $13.4 million for Project Sildor. The renewal with Lamixek Holdings closes at $48.9 million a year, 49 percent above the last contract.

Subject: Handover — pinning policy items for eng sync

Team, passing the release baton to Maren after this cycle. Main open item: the Fernwick pinning policy now requires exact-version pins for all transitive deps in the Oakhollow manifest, and pinned lockfiles must be signed before merge. Lockfile signatures are verified against the key below.

rollout seal: bky4_x7Gc